Joining the AFA


There are two ways of joining the Alberta Fencing Association. You can either join the AFA through a registered club, or you can join as an unaffiliated member and apply directly to the AFA


Membership Levels

There are 2 membership levels to choose from depending on what level of participation in AFA events you wish to have.

Associate Membership (ASSC) - $15

The associate membership category allows individuals to partake in classes and events at affiliated clubs.
Benefits include:

  • Liability insurance coverage
  • Supporting the development of coaching and refereeing in Alberta
  • Administrative coordination between the clubs, provinces, and the Canadian Fencing Federation
  • Ability to sign up for various courses and events offered by the AFA

Competitive Membership (COMP) - $50

The competitive membership category provides all of the services of the associate membership level, as well as:

  • The ability to participate at a competitive level in Alberta and at out-of-province/country events
  • Being included in the Alberta Provincial rankings, and being eligible for performance funding
  • Subsidizing referees for provincial competitions
  • Subsidizing the purchase and maintenance of provincial tournament equipment
